Chris Martin Gets The Chop! ...more Coldplay »

A duet between Chris Martin and Nelly Furtado has been mysteriously dropped from the Canadian songstress?s comeback album.

Martin had recorded the track ?All Good Things? for Furtado?s Timbaland produced long player but the song has apparently been removed at the request of Coldplay?s label.

A source told the Daily Star: ?nelly and Chris don?t have a problem and loved every minute of working together. You can even hear them having a laugh at the end of the song.?

?But three days ago the order came through to remove it from the album. It seems EMI have a problem rather than either of the artists. I don?t know if Chris knows yet but when he finds out he?ll be furious.?

Martin had previously recorded vocals for The Streets track ?Dry Your Eyes? but that was also pulled by EMI.
